Benzo(a)pyrene and PAHs in banana chips
Slovakia: Slovakian authorities have warned about a sample of 'Racionella' Banana chips with raw material from the Phillipines.
In the sample, an excess amount of benzo (a) pyrene = 5.9μg/kg (max = 2μg/kg) and an excess amount of PAH4 = 45μg/kg (limit = max. 20 µg/kg) were found.
The 80g product has date 23-11-17 and has been withdrawn from the market.
